Preparing for Your Biometric Services Appointment

After you file your application, petition, or request, if you need to provide your fingerprints, photograph, or signature, USCIS will schedule your biometric services appointment at a local Application Support Center (ASC). USCIS has the general authority to require and collect biometrics from any applicant, petitioner, sponsor, beneficiary, or other individual residing in the United States for any immigration and naturalization benefit. See 8 CFR 103.2 (b)(9).

USCIS Launches Online Rescheduling of Biometrics Appointments

New tool provides option to reschedule a biometric services appointment online without calling the USCIS Contact Center

WASHINGTON—On June 28, U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services launched a new self-service tool allowing benefit requestors, and their attorneys and accredited representatives, to reschedule most biometric services appointments before the date of the appointment.
